Yeah, Norinco SKSs have that ability. I remember wanting to buy a Paratrooper variant that can take AK mags.
Anyway, off topic. Revolvers can mess up if abused. The timing can be thrown off, has problems when dropped in lots of dirt or sand. Anything that hinders the rotation of the cylinder of a revolver will cause it to stop working. Anything that keeps the cylinder from locking up at the right place (timing) can affect its ability to fire. Something as simple as lint from a pocket or purse can stop a revolver from working. It does not take sand to stop a revolver.
